víri kun there it is; there they are
Dictionary Entry
lexicon ID #6572 | revised Jan 14 2016
víri kun • MWU • there it is; there they are
Derivation: | víri kun- |
so 3pl(>3s) |
Source: WB files
- yee, víri kún káan xás kun'iin, pakéevniikich káru pa'ifápiit. Well, there the two of them were, the old woman and the girl. [Reference: WB T57.71]
- víri îifuti poopitrûuputi víri kún yúruk úmkuufhiti. Sure enough, when he looked downriver, there downriver was the smoke. [Reference: WB T61.36]
